The arrested terrorists belong to the banned organization.


Lahore: Counter Terrorism Department (CTD) Punjab arrested four terrorists while conducting Intelligence Based Operations (IBOs) in different cities.
According to details, explosive materials and other items were also recovered from the suspects.
CTD spokesperson said that the terrorists were arrested during operations in Sheikhupura, Sargodha, Sahiwal and Rawalpindi.
The spokesman also told that explosive materials, detonators, mobile phones and cash were also recovered from the arrested terrorists.
Arrested terrorists belong to the banned organization, however four cases have been registered against the accused.
The officials added: “A total of 166 combing operations were conducted this week, in which 22 suspects have been arrested”.
